Town hall Neu-Saar Werden | In 1701 Ludwig Carto von Nassau-Saarbrücken founded a new administrative center for his estates on the left bank of the Saar. The place was built with a road network of right-angled streets. With the political reorganization after the French Revolution, Neu- Saar Werden and Bockenheim were united to form the Saar Union. The town hall had had its day and was a Protestant school until 1956. The building is located in a square in the center of town. It is a two-story plastered building with a crooked hip roof and originally an open portico. The space between the columns was lined with brick and closed with round arches. The entablature and the outermost pillars have been preserved and are visible. Nine simple window axes illuminate the long side of the upper floor, five the gable side. Corner blocks and cornices structure the historical building.

Sarre-Union town hall | The town hall was built in 1684 at the instigation of Louis XIV, in 1773 it was restored and slightly changed. The two-story plastered building on the eaves is dominated by three round arches on the street side on the ground floor. The middle one serves as an entrance, the two outer ones are filled with windows and underneath protected by a wall with a wrought iron railing.

Portal, door and bay window of a residential building | The house on Rue du Couvent is a two-storey plastered eaves building with three window axes from the 17th century. The triangular bay window with a crowning figure on the roof end, which holds another roof that is cranked with the sills on the upper floor, is striking. The portal consists of two fluted pilasters that support an entablature. Above it sits a rectangular gable field with ornaments and a straight roofing at the end.

Residential building | The two-storey plastered eaves building was erected in the third quarter of the 16th century as the winter residence of Vogts von Bockenheim Johannes Streiff von Laufenstein. The house was rebuilt in the 18th century. The polygonal renaissance bay window, which extends over both floors, was preserved. The portal is inspired by the Baroque and has a lunette window with a grid in front of it.

Bay window | The building at Grand-Rue 25 is a narrow three-story plastered building with three axes on the ground floor and two on the two upper floors. On the first floor there is a triangular bay window supported by a console with a figure. In the fields below the window sits a cartouche with a head and a brooding bird. The year 1620 indicates the date of construction.

Residential house, sheep farm | The two-storey plastered building with a crooked hip roof was created in 1714 for Johannes Heinrich Karcher and his wife. An entrance portal sits in the center of the seven axes on the ground floor. The entrance door is supported by two pilasters with bud capitals. In between there is a field with the inscription of the owners and a sheep with a banner in a cartouche. Above a profiled entablature ornament field with straight roofing, which is supported by cuboids with angel heads. Above it sits an arched gable flanked by spheres on pedestals.

Former Reformed Church | The church was built in 1750/51 and was intended to serve as a place of worship for the Huguenots who fled to the Protestant county of Saar Werden. The transept church is equipped with segmented arched windows. A baroque portal with aedicula and round arch forms the entrance to the rectangular hall. An oculus sits above it. Behind the transverse rectangular building block sits a drawn-in extension. Sandstone pilaster strips structure the plastered structure. The architect of the building was probably Friedrich Joachim Stengel .
